Maintenance Planning Analyst
Are you ready to coordinate and lead within the engineering function? As a Maintenance Planning Analyst, you'll act as a vital link between customers and the engineering department, driving planning excellence in your area. Your role will be pivotal in ensuring seamless operations and effective resource allocation.
Accountabilities:
- Produce detailed plans of engineering activities, ensuring all required elements are included.
- Engage with production teams to create a comprehensive manufacturing and maintenance plan, aligning it with key procedures like Maintenance Excellence and accounting for major production outages.
- Ensure effective coordination of external contractor or supplier work with internal manufacturing and maintenance plans.
- Allocate internal and external resources appropriately for both planned and unplanned activities and take necessary actions to reschedule activities when required.
- Collaborate with external suppliers to identify cost-effective material solutions, leveraging proficient knowledge of engineering systems and requirements.
- Contribute to engineering and maintenance improvement initiatives through the application of Manufacturing Extension Partnership principles.
- Measure planning effectiveness regularly to ensure compliance with engineering standards and objectives.
- Provide expert training, guidance, and coaching to less experienced colleagues and new team members.
- Plan maintenance activities by coordinating with customers and managing line availability to meet operational needs.
- Identify safety, health, and environmental reviews for work orders and oversee the approval process.
- Monitor maintenance backlog, prioritize work orders based on criticality, and co-manage performance metrics for assigned areas.
- Use CMMS tools effectively for continuous improvement in maintenance planning and execution.
- Scope maintenance work orders comprehensively, identifying necessary materials and coordinating their purchase, delivery, and staging.
- Collaborate with Procurement for material availability, expediting orders, and managing service contracts for repairs and site services.
- Serve as a subject matter expert in CMMS work orders and preventive maintenance modules, ensuring compliance with audit and internal requirements.
- Drive continuous improvement efforts by using Lean and Reliability principles, analyzing maintenance processes, and proposing cross-functional advancements.
- Integrate CMMS into SAP and ensure the accuracy and reliability of master data while adapting to business process changes.
- Retain technical maintenance documents, including preventive and corrective maintenance work orders, to comply with company standards and retention policies.
Essential Skills/Experience:
- HS Diploma/GED/Military Experience
- 0 to 5 yrs of experience in maintenance, facilities or bio pharma
- Proficient with cGMP maintenance, facilities or planner functions; Skilled in CMMS, Microsoft Office Suite, and Coupa
- Strong working knowledge of cGMPs and GLS related to maintenance processes and documentation
- Excellent interpersonal and communication skills; Exceptional attention to detail for high accuracy and completeness
- Effective organizational, administrative, and time-management abilities; Demonstrated ability to make sound business decisions and exercise good judgment
- Technical proficiency in engineering principles and specific operational areas; Familiar with procedures ensuring compliance with GXP and Safety, Health, and Environment standards
Desirable Skills/Experience:
- Formal training in CMMS system
- Comprehensive understanding of building facilities management and manufacturing operations
- Bachelor’s degree in a relevant field
